LRP1 Antibody (8B8) is a mouse monoclonal IgG1 kappa light chain antibody designed to detect the Low-Density Lipoprotein Receptor-Related Protein 1 (LRP1), also known as the α2-Macroglobulin Receptor (α2MR). LRP1 is a multifunctional endocytic receptor that plays a pivotal role in the internalization of a wide array of ligands, including α2-Macroglobulin and apolipoprotein E (apoE), which are essential for lipid metabolism, protease clearance, and cellular signaling pathways. Structurally, LRP1 is characterized by its extensive extracellular domain composed of multiple clusters of cysteine-rich class A repeats, epidermal growth factor (EGF)-like repeats, YWTD repeats, and an O-linked sugar domain, which are critical for ligand binding and receptor function. Post-translational modifications of LRP1, such as glycosylation and proteolytic cleavage, are crucial for proper folding, trafficking to the cell surface, and the formation of functional membrane and extracellular subunits. These modifications ensure that LRP1 maintains structural integrity and binding affinity, thereby facilitating its role in maintaining cellular homeostasis and mediating endocytosis. LRP1 (8B8) antibody is raised against the light chain of full-length native human LRP1 across multiple species, including mouse, rat, human, and rabbit. LRP1 monoclonal antibody (8B8) is recommended for use in various applications such as western blotting (WB), immunofluorescence (IF), immunohistochemistry (IHC), and flow cytometry (FCM), making it a versatile research tool.
